Why 45W Is the Sweet Spot

The choice of 45W is not random. With the convergence of ultrabooks, tablets, and smartphones, 45W has emerged as a “sweet spot”—sufficient to power mainstream ultrabooks while also meeting the ultra-fast charging needs of smartphones.

The Shift Towards Portable and Universal Power Solutions

Consumers are no longer willing to carry two chargers. In 2026, with multi-device mobile work (laptop + phone) becoming standard, single-function chargers are being marginalized. Market research shows that over 70% of professional users prefer smaller adapters with dual-port plug-and-play fast charging.

For distributors, this means fewer SKUs and higher inventory turnover.

Understanding GaN Technology and Its Role in Heat Dissipation

The benefits of GaN technology go beyond size reduction—they also include higher switching frequencies. High-frequency switching reduces the size requirements for transformers and magnetic components but introduces severe EMI (electromagnetic interference) and heat dissipation challenges.

Protocol Compatibility: Ensuring Fast Charging for Laptops

The table below outlines the key protocols that determine charger compatibility and global market applicability:

Key Protocol Type Core Value Target Market / Devices
USB PD 3.1 Upward compatibility & extended power High-end laptops, premium peripherals
PPS (Programmable Power Supply) Precise constant current & voltage Samsung, Android fast-charging devices
QC 5.0 High-voltage fast charging Qualcomm-based devices
UFCS (Unified Fast Charging Standard) Compliance with Chinese standards Domestic sales in China

Safety Features: Over-Voltage, Over-Current, and Temperature Protection

A charger is not just a voltage converter—it is the first line of defense for protecting expensive user devices. Beyond basic OCP (over-current protection) and OVP (over-voltage protection), a mature manufacturer must integrate NTC thermistors and firmware algorithms for real-time monitoring.

Millisecond-level cutoffs in response to FOD (foreign object detection) or short-circuit risks are critical for protecting brand reputation.

How Inconsistent Production Impacts Returns and Reviews

The scariest problem in the supply chain isn’t “high cost” but “high variability.” For frequently used electronics like 45W dual-port chargers, batch-to-batch quality fluctuations can cause major headaches.

If the first batch performs well but subsequent production has coil whine or excessive heat, customers leave negative reviews on Amazon or independent sites. Avoid this by evaluating the manufacturer’s closed-loop production processes—from IQC (incoming quality control) to FOT (function testing on the line) and aging tests—any missing step compromises your brand’s future.
